stadsroute
Stadsroute is a Dutch term that translates to city route or urban route. It refers to a planned or designated path through a city that is intended for pedestrians and/or cyclists, with the aim of uncovering notable sites, architecture, culture, and history along the way. Routes are typically published by municipalities, tourism boards, museums, or cultural organizations and can be self-guided or part of a guided program.
